Case Profile for The Informant

The Informant will collect secrets from any area of the Government and sell them to the highest bidder. He also works for Prescott, the man that has been blackmailing Donald Ressler since the end of season four. Will Ressler be able to stop The Informant and turn him in? Or will he continue being manipulated and turn into the bad cop he fears? Luckily for Ressler the good Red from up above is watching his six and comes to his aide at a most needed time.

Meanwhile Liz continues her quest to find Tom’s killers. She has most of the mayhem figured out except for the man with the Damascus knife, one Ian Garvey. Garvey gets word Liz is back, in town that is. She’s not back at the FBI working with the task force. She narrows in on Garvey’s second hand man Navarro, whom reveals to Liz that what she thought she understood about Tom’s involvement may not be completely true.

The Music of The Informant

We kick off the show in a club to the sounds of Alexis Smith, Joe Henson, and Oliver Dalston and their collaboration ‘Nightlife’. It’s really a killer tune. Or was it the dry ice? Then toward the end of the episode, when Red decides to take care of Prescott once and for all we hear Gracie and Rachel’s ‘Upside Down’, as those secret envelopes are passed between Ressler and Cooper.
